Top 10 Places in Al Mafraq

Jordan Border
Jordan Border

Al Mafraq,
Al Mafraq Local business

Al Mafraq, Tabuk, Saudi Arabia
Al Mafraq, Tabuk, Saudi Arabia

Al Mafraq,
Al Mafraq City

طريق السعودية
طريق السعودية

Al Mafraq,
Al Mafraq Local business

Results 1 - 3 of 3